Peru coach Gareca says team won't man-mark Messi

Lima, Oct 3: Peru are unlikely to man-mark Argenti forward Lionel Messi in the teams’ crucial World Cup qualifier on Thursday, according to Blanquirroja coach Ricardo Gareca.

Peru are currently fourth in the South American zone’s CONMEBOL standings and will secure a berth in their first World Cup fils since 1982 if they beat Argenti in Buenos Aires and Colombia in Lima five days later, reports Xinhua news agency.

“Messi is a player who is admired all over the world,” Gareca told a news conference.

“We have never man-marked anybody and we’re not likely to do it (on Thursday),” he added.

“We will be totally prepared for whatever comes our way. We are in good shape physically, psychologically and also from a football standpoint and we believe we can achieve our objective.”

Andre Carrillo, Christian Cueva, Paolo Hurtado and Christian Ramos will miss the match at the Bombonera due to suspension while striker Jefferson Farfan remains under an injury cloud. IANS
